Job description
We are seeking a Senior IT Voice Engineer for our enterprise voice and network environment. This role will contribute as a team member for both Cisco CUCM and Microsoft Teams Voice, playing a critical role in our active migration from Cisco to Microsoft Teams Voice. The ideal candidate has deep hands-on experience, strong architectural skills, and a proven ability to lead complex voice migrations while maintaining operational stability., Voice Architecture
- Support the migration from Cisco CUCM to Microsoft Teams Voice.
- Design voice architecture, including Direct Routing, Calling Plans, and hybrid scenarios
- Provide expert-level support for Microsoft Teams Voice, Cisco CUCM, Unity Connection, CCX, gateways, and SIP integrations during transition
- Configure, manage, and optimize Session Border Controllers (SBCs)
- Develop and maintain dial plans, call routing, normalization rules, and number porting strategies
- Analyze and resolve complex call quality and signaling issues
Network & Infrastructure Engineering
- Ensure enterprise network readiness for Teams Voice, including QoS, bandwidth planning, and latency optimization
- Support enterprise LAN/WAN environments with a focus on voice quality and QoS
- Configure and troubleshoot VLANs, QoS, routing, and switching
- Collaborate with network and security teams to ensure voice traffic reliability and security
- Monitor system performance and proactively address issues
Operations
- Work closely with vendors, carriers, and Microsoft/Cisco support
- Establish operational standards, monitoring, and documentation
- Develop continuous improvement initiatives for voice and collaboration services
Requirements
- Strong hands-on experience with Microsoft Teams Voice, preferably Direct Routing
- Extensive experience supporting Cisco CUCM in large enterprise environments
- Deep understanding of SIP, VoIP, RTP, TLS, and telephony signaling
- Proven experience leading or architecting voice migration projects
- Strong networking fundamentals (QoS, VLANs, routing, switching)
- Advanced troubleshooting skills across voice and network layers
